Yummy apple dip!

I finally fixed a yummy apple dip that definitely kills the sweet tooth!

1/4 cup unflavored Greek yogurt

1/2 tbs PB2

1/2 tbs Vanilla Torani sugar free syrup

Mix it all together and yummy! It makes enough dip to generously dip a whole apple. Enjoy!
